A Postgraduate Certificate in Cross-cultural Game Technology provides specialized training in developing and marketing games for diverse global audiences. This intensive program equips students with the skills to navigate cultural nuances, localization strategies, and global game markets.
Learning outcomes for this certificate include a deep understanding of cross-cultural communication in game design, proficiency in game localization techniques (including translation and adaptation), and the ability to conduct market research across diverse cultural contexts. Students develop skills in international game publishing and distribution strategies.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Cross-cultural Game Technology typically ranges from six months to one year, depending on the institution and program structure. Many programs offer flexible online learning options, accommodating busy professionals. Full-time and part-time study options may be available.
This postgraduate certificate is highly relevant to the games industry, addressing the growing need for culturally sensitive game development. Graduates are prepared for roles in game design, localization, international marketing, and global publishing. Understanding player behavior, cultural sensitivity, and global distribution channels are vital in the increasingly interconnected gaming world; this certificate directly addresses these needs. The program fosters collaboration, project management skills, and intercultural competency – essential assets for successful careers in the global game development and publishing market.
Furthermore, a strong emphasis is placed on practical application, often incorporating real-world case studies and collaborative projects that mirror the demands of the global game development sector. Game engine proficiency, user interface design, and global market analysis are integrated throughout the curriculum.

Why this course?
A Postgraduate Certificate in Cross-cultural Game Technology is increasingly significant in today's globalized game development market. The UK games industry, a major player worldwide, generated £7.4 billion in revenue in 2022, showcasing its robust growth. This success hinges on understanding diverse player bases, and a postgraduate certificate specializing in cross-cultural game technology directly addresses this critical need. The course equips professionals with the skills to design, develop, and market games effectively across different cultural contexts, considering factors such as language, art styles, narrative structure, and social norms. This interdisciplinary approach to game design is paramount for creating truly global gaming experiences that resonate with international audiences. According to a recent report, over 70% of UK game studios are actively seeking candidates with experience in localization and cultural sensitivity.
